A 48-year-old Toronto man has been charged in connection with the alleged sexual assault of a girl in Port Hope and Toronto over a seven-year period.

According to police, the victim was sexually assaulted in the Highway 2 and Dale Road area in Port Hope and in the Danforth Road and Eglinton Avenue area in Toronto between 2008 and January 2015.

As part of the ongoing investigation, search warrants were executed and computer equipment was seized. Images of children being sexually abused were subsequently found on the computer equipment, police allege.

It is also alleged that between 2008 and 2012, a woman was sexually assaulted in the same area of Port Hope as the child victim.

The suspect lived in the Port Hope are from 2005 to 2012 before moving to Toronto, investigators said. He was employed as a long-haul truck driver, travelling both within Ontario and into the United States as far as Arizona.

Police believe there may be more victims.

A suspect identified as James Simmerson faces 10 charges, including three counts of sexual assault, two counts of sexual exploitation, and possession of child pornography.
